Stock DNA
Computers - Software & Consulting
USD 3,177 Million (Small Cap)
NA (Loss Making)
NA
0.00%
-0.90
-35.24%
10.11
Total Returns (Price + Dividend) 
Rumble, Inc. for the last several years.
Risk Adjusted Returns v/s 
News

Rumble, Inc. Hits Day Low at $6.20 Amid Price Pressure
Rumble, Inc. has faced significant stock price challenges, with a notable decline in recent weeks and a year-to-date loss of over 52%. The company's financial metrics reveal operational difficulties, including a negative return on equity and EBITDA, while its majority shareholders are mutual funds navigating a tough market environment.
Read More
Rumble, Inc. Experiences Revision in Stock Evaluation Amid Mixed Performance Indicators
Rumble, Inc., a small-cap company in the Computers - Software & Consulting sector, has experienced significant stock fluctuations, with a 52-week range of $5.25 to $17.40. Despite recent challenges reflected in year-to-date performance, the company has outperformed the S&P 500 over the past year.
Read MoreIs Rumble, Inc. technically bullish or bearish?
As of 10 October 2025, the technical trend for Rumble, Inc. has changed from mildly bearish to bearish. The current stance is bearish, with key indicators supporting this view including bearish MACD readings on both the weekly and monthly time frames, and a bearish signal from daily moving averages. Bollinger Bands also indicate a bearish trend on the weekly and mildly bearish on the monthly. The KST shows a bearish signal weekly while being bullish monthly, which adds some complexity but does not negate the overall bearish stance. In terms of performance, Rumble has underperformed the S&P 500 year-to-date with a return of -39.74% compared to the S&P's 11.41%, although it has outperformed the index over the past year with a return of 45.45% versus 13.36%....
Read More Announcements 
Corporate Actions 
Quality key factors 
Valuation key factors
Technicals key factors
Shareholding Snapshot : Mar 2025
Shareholding Compare (%holding) 
Domestic Funds
Held in 15 Schemes (3.94%)
Held by 46 Foreign Institutions (0.76%)
Quarterly Results Snapshot (Consolidated) - Jun'25 - YoY
YoY Growth in quarter ended Jun 2025 is 11.56% vs -10.00% in Jun 2024
YoY Growth in quarter ended Jun 2025 is -12.69% vs 9.15% in Jun 2024
Annual Results Snapshot (Consolidated) - Dec'24
YoY Growth in year ended Dec 2024 is 17.90% vs 105.58% in Dec 2023
YoY Growth in year ended Dec 2024 is -190.72% vs -921.05% in Dec 2023






